Structural foundation repair services address iss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ve assessing the existing foundation to identify problems such as cracks, settling, or shifting. Repair methods may include underpinning, piering, or injecting stabilization materials to restore proper support. The goal is to ensure the building remains structurally sound, preventing further damage and maintaining safety for occupants.
Foundation problems often manifest through vis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, doors or windows that stick, or noticeable shifts in the structure’s alignment. Left unaddressed, these issues can lead to more severe damage, including compromised load-bearing elements and increased repair costs. Structural foundation repair services help resolve these problems by stabilizing the foundation, preventing further movement, and reinforcing the building’s underlying support system.

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ost range for foundation repair services varies widely, often between $2,000 and $7,500 depending on the extent of damage and repair methods used. For minor cracks, expenses may be closer to $2,000, while major underpinning can exceed $10,000.
Factors Influencing Costs - Costs are influenced by factors such as soil conditions, foundation type, and accessibility. In Springfield, IL, repairs for typical residential foundations usually fall within the $3,000 to $8,000 range.
Common Repair Methods - Methods like piering or slabjacking generally cost between $1,000 and $4,000 per pier, with total expenses depending on the number of piers needed. Larger projects involving extensive underpinning can significantly increase the overall cost.
Additional Expenses - Additional costs may include excavation, permits, and structural reinforcement, which can add $1,000 to $5,000 to the total project.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ific foundation issues.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ators may include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ly, and gaps around window frames or exterior walls.
How do contractors typically repair foundation problems? Repair methods can involve underpinning, piering, or slab stabilization, depending on the type and severity of the foundation issue.
Are foundation repairs nec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; however, significant or growing cracks may indicate underlying problems that need assessment and possibly repair by a professional.
What factors influence the cost of foundation repair? Costs can vary based on the extent of damage, repair method chosen, soil conditions, and the size of the affected area.
How can homeowners prevent future foundation problems? Proper drainage, maintaining soil moisture levels, and addressing minor issues early can help prevent further foundation damage; consulting with local pros can provide tailored advice.
